Discover more about Letoon Sanctuary Place

The Letoon Sanctuary, an essential site within the UNESCO World Heritage-listed Lycia region, invites visitors to explore its captivating ruins and experience the spiritual ambiance of ancient worship. Once a significant religious center dedicated to the goddess Leto and her children, Apollo and Artemis, this historical landmark features a collection of well-preserved temples, altars, and inscriptions that speak to its storied past. As you wander through the site, you'll be mesmerized by the intricate details of the structures and the lush landscapes that envelop them. In addition to its architectural beauty, the Letoon Sanctuary is surrounded by the stunning natural scenery of the Turkish countryside. The tranquil atmosphere of the site makes it an excellent spot for leisurely strolls, photography, and reflection. The sanctuary's historical significance is further enhanced by its proximity to other ancient sites, including the nearby city of Xanthos, allowing visitors to immerse themselves in the rich tapestry of Lycian history. Plan your visit during the warmer months for the best experience, as the site is open daily from 8:30 AM to 5:30 PM. Be sure to wear comfortable shoes, as the terrain can be uneven, and bring plenty of water to stay hydrated while exploring. With its combination of cultural history, breathtaking views, and serene ambiance, the Letoon Sanctuary is a treasure trove for tourists seeking to delve into the ancient world of Lycia.
